Are people in Dunedin older or younger than people in Cleveland?
- The Median Age in Dunedin is 23.7 years older than in Cleveland.

Are housing costs cheaper in Dunedin or Cleveland?
- Dunedin housing costs are 68.0% more expensive than Cleveland hous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Dunedin or Cleveland?
- The average commute for residents of Dunedin is 8.1 minutes longer than it is for residents of Cleveland.
